Massive Blaze Breaks Out at Anand Vihar Hospital
New Delhi: A major fire erupted at Kosmos Hospital in Anand Vihar, East Delhi, on Saturday afternoon, resulting in one fatality and injuring at least 10 others, officials from the Delhi Fire Service confirmed.

Fire Response and Current Status
The fire was reported at 12:12 pm, prompting an immediate response with eight fire tenders dispatched to the scene, according to PTI. The blaze has since been brought under control. The cause of the fire remains under investigation.

Casualties and Rescue Efforts
Seven of the injured patients were admitted to Kosmos Hospital itself, while three sustained minor injuries. RK Sachdeva, the hospital owner, stated that hospital staff and a cleaning worker managed to rescue several patients. Unfortunately, the cleaning staff member reportedly locked himself in a bathroom and was among the casualties.
